Bank Strike Alert: Four-Day Closure Looms Over Five-Day Work Week Demand
- •Bank employees plan a strike on January 27, 2026, demanding a five-day work week.
- •The strike, combined with existing holidays (Jan 24-26), could lead to a four-day bank closure.
- •Unions argue a five-day week reduces workload, boosts efficiency, and aligns with other financial institutions.
- •United Forum of Bank Unions (UFBU) proposes extending daily working hours by 40 minutes to compensate for Saturdays.
- •The Indian Banks' Association (IBA) and All India Bank Officers' Confederation have agreed to the five-day week, pending government notification.
Why It Matters: Bank employees' demand for a five-day work week could lead to a four-day bank closure in January 2026.
